Xbox moves the Enterprise easter egg into somewhere more obvious to see. It also increased the texture quality, and removed the Bégoniax music. The PC version also removes the Glidewalk and the standard method of doing IPG in ToTL.

Xbox has the highest jump height but the slowest movement speed. Both of these are almost not noticeable for casual players but there are several jumps that work on Xbox but not on other platforms (the jump height order is Xbox > GC > PS2 > PC). Not a big deal though.

2D Nightmare isn't really available, you have to put an action replay code to unlock it.
RayWiki wrote: In the GameCube version of Rayman 3, 2D Madness is unlocked simply by connecting a Game Boy Advance to the console. In the other console and PC versions of Rayman 3, it is unlocked by earning a certain number of points in-game. 2D Nightmare can reportedly be unlocked by connecting a 100%-complete GameCube version of Rayman 3 to a 100%-complete Game Boy Advance version of Rayman 3, but this method has not worked when attempted. Efforts to contact Ubisoft regarding 2D Nightmare were made, but produced no constructive responses.

While the official method remains unknown, the minigame can still be accessed through the use of the following Action Replay codes:

NTSC:

0A42F5C8 00000040
005D884F 0000000A
0A42F5C8 00000020
005D884F 0000000B

PAL:

0A42EAE8 00000040
025D7D6E 0000000A
0A42EAE8 00000020
025D7D6E 0000000B

After entering the code, select a minigame (preferably Racquet Jump), and press L for 2D Nightmare, or R for 2D Madness.
